The last couple weeks - viz on Hood Canal has been improving.
Yesterday - Flagpole presented a good 40 feet Viz. When viz is this clear - it is so cool to see more of the structure (all at the same time). The amount of schooling rock fish is also pretty cool to watch and take in! At Elephant Wall - viz today was at least 35 feet - in that at 35 deep, I could easily see the surface of the water.
I cannot remember a time when so many octo dens populated on these sites. It's really fun to go visit the dens and see what everyone is up to. And - I keep finding more. A den at Elephant Wall that I had not visited for quite a while (it's at 95 to 100 feet deep), just had the female pass away. Sad to see the female octo cycle of life end. Speaking of the cycle of life - fish are all around the GPOs with eggs. They are just waiting for they day to snack on baby octos. Wish there was a "fish repellant" to use to keep those baby octos safe.

Btw if you see a dead mom, do look around for babies in a nearby den. Hatching can continue for a while after the mom dies, albeit usually much more slowly. If you find just the eggs, try looking close and/or fanning them gently.
